Top 8 females perform

Filed under: Competition, American Idol Season 6 — cara @ 1:49 pm

Wednesday, March 7th

Jordin Sparks

Heartbreaker - Pat Benatar

I really liked Jordin’s performance tonight, but I didn’t think she got the credit she deserved from Simon. I’m sure that this is a really hard song to sing, and she did it so well. It was energetic and fun and it showed a lot of personality. Simon said it sounded a bit shreeky, but then he also said that she would definitely be here next week.

Sabrina Sloan

I wasn’t pleased with Sabrina tonight. Paula really complimented her voice, but I think it was extremely shaky and very pitchy in places. I really liked the song though, but I don’t think she did it justice. It also sounded like she was just screaming during a lot of it.

Antonella Barba

This week, Antonella picked a song that suited her voice a lot better. However, it was still pretty terrible. The way she sang tonight was nowhere near the level that American Idol demands. It kind of sucks because she is the worst singer in the competition, but she never gets voted out. I think the only reason she managed to make it though each round is by her looks, and perhaps the fact that there are suggestive pictures of her on the internet.

Haley Scarnato

If My Heart Had Wings – Faith Hill

I thought this was another bad performance. It was an odd song choice, and she couldn’t pull it off. I have a feeling that she doesn’t really understand how to improve, because she has yet to choose a perfect song for her. It was so boring.

Stephanie Edwards

Stephanie has an amazing voice, but there is something that bothers me about her, and that is that she is too typical. She sounds almost identical to Beyonce, which isn’t necessarily a bad thing, but we already have a voice like that in the industry. Another problem I have with her is that she takes a song, and sings it exactly the way it is. There is no originality to it, and that worries me.

Lakisha Jones

I Have Nothing - Whitney Houston

Once again, she had an amazing performance. It probably wasn’t her best performance ever, but it was still amazing. You never see her make mistakes, and it’s really rare to find a person who alwaya has a good performance. The judges all really like it.

Gina Glocksen

Call Me When You’re Sober – Evanescence

I thought this was a much better song choice for Gina. It was a bit more rock, which I think really suits her. However, it’s a pretty hard song, and she didn’t sound near as good as Evanesence. Overall though, I thought she did a decent job. There were a few pitchy spots, but she has potential.

Melinda Doolittle

W-O-M-A-N

This performance was just so fun. You could tell she really had a good time with it, and that made the whole thing that much better. For me, Melinda is the most consistent girl of the bunch (and perhaps Lakisha too.) As the competition goes on, I can’t wait to see what Melinda will do next. She is amazing.
